1. What is Autel MaxiSys and Why Should You Care About Its Cost?

The Autel MaxiSys is a powerful and versatile automotive diagnostic system designed to help technicians quickly and accurately diagnose vehicle issues. It’s essentially a comprehensive toolkit in one device, offering functionalities such as:

  • Diagnostic Scans: Read and clear di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s) from various vehicle systems.
  • Live Data Streaming: Monitor real-time data from sensors and components.
  • Actuation Tests: Test the functionality of specific components, like fuel injectors or solenoids.
  • ECU Programming: Perform advanced functions such as ECU coding and programming (on select models).
  • Service Functions: Reset maintenance lights, calibrate sensors, and perform other routine service procedures.

2. Key Factors Influencing the Autel MaxiSys Cost

Several key factors influence the Autel MaxiSys cost, including:

  • Model and Features: The MaxiSys line includes various models, from entry-level options to high-end, all-encompassing systems. Advanced features like ECU programming, oscilloscope integration, and wireless connectivity increase the price.
  • Software Updates and Subscriptions: Autel provides regular software updates to keep the MaxiSys compatible with the latest vehicle models and diagnostic protocols. These updates often require a subscription, which adds to the overall cost.
  • Hardware Specifications: The processing power, screen size, memory, and build quality of the device itself contribute to the price. Models with faster processors and more robust designs tend to cost more.
  • Included Accessories: Some MaxiSys packages come with additional accessories like adapters, cables, and carrying cases, which can affect the overall price.
  • Vendor and Location: The price can vary depending on where you purchase the MaxiSys. Authorized dealers may offer competitive pricing and support but could still vary based on geographic location due to shipping, taxes, and other regional costs.
  • Warranty and Support: A longer warranty period and access to technical support can justify a higher price tag, providing peace of mind and protection for your investment.

3. Autel MaxiSys Models and Their Corresponding Costs

The Autel MaxiSys series offers a range of models tailored to different needs and budgets. Here’s an overview of some popular models and their approximate costs:

Model Key Features Approximate Cost
Autel MaxiSys MS906 Basic diagnostics, service functions, and live data streaming. $1,200 – $1,500
Autel MaxiSys MS908 Advanced diagnostics, ECU coding, and bi-directional control. $2,500 – $3,000
Autel MaxiSys MS909 Comprehensive diagnostics, ECU programming, and topology mapping. $4,000 – $4,500
Autel MaxiSys Ultra Top-of-the-line diagnostics, J2534 programming, and advanced analysis tools. $5,000 – $6,000+
Autel MaxiSys Elite II Enhanced performance, advanced ECU programming, and extensive vehicle coverage $4,500 – $5,500
Autel MaxiCheck MX900 Wireless diagnostics, cloud-based reporting, and special functions $1,800 – $2,200

Note: Prices may vary depending on the vendor, promotions, and included accessories.

5. The Importance of Software Updates and Subscriptions in the Overall Autel MaxiSys Cost

Software updates and subscriptions are a crucial aspect of owning an Autel MaxiSys tool. These updates provide:

  • Compatibility with New Vehicle Models: Automakers release new models every year with updated systems and technologies. Software updates ensure your MaxiSys can accurately diagnose and service these vehicles.
  • Access to New Diagnostic Procedures: Updates include new diagnostic procedures, tests, and functions, allowing you to tackle a wider range of automotive issues.
  • Bug Fixes and Performance Improvements: Software updates often include bug fixes and performance improvements, ensuring your MaxiSys operates smoothly and reliably.
  • Enhanced Security: Updates can include security patches to protect your device and vehicle systems from potential cyber threats.

Failing to keep your MaxiSys software up to date can lead to:

  • Inaccurate Diagnostic Readings: Outdated software may not be able to accurately interpret data from newer vehicle systems, leading to misdiagnosis.
  • Inability to Access Certain Functions: Some diagnostic functions may not work correctly or be unavailable without the latest software updates.
  • Security Vulnerabilities: Outdated software may be vulnerable to security threats, potentially compromising your device and vehicle systems.

Subscription Costs:

Autel typically offers software update subscriptions on an annual basis. The cost of these subscriptions varies depending on the MaxiSys model and the level of coverage provided. On average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$1,500 per year for software updates. 6. Comparing Autel MaxiSys Costs to Other Diagnostic Tools

When evaluating the Autel MaxiSys cost, it’s helpful to compare it to other diagnostic tools on the market. Here’s a brief comparison:

Brand Model Approximate Cost Key Features
Autel MaxiSys Ultra $5,000 – $6,000+ J2534 programming, advanced oscilloscope, intelligent diagnostics.
Snap-on Zeus $8,000 – $10,000+ Advanced diagnostics, guided component tests, integrated information system.
Launch X431 V+ $1,500 – $2,000 Complete system diagnostics, service functions, remote diagnostics.
Bosch ADS 625 $2,000 – $2,500 Full system scan, bi-directional control, integrated repair information.
Matco Tools Maximus 3.0 $6,000 – $7,000+ Comprehensive diagnostics, ECU programming, advanced graphing capabilities.

11. Common Issues and Troubleshooting Tips for Autel MaxiSys

Even with proper maintenance, you may encounter issues with your Autel MaxiSys. Here are some common problems and troubleshooting tips:

Issue Troubleshooting Tips
Tool Won’t Power On Check the battery charge level. Try a different power adapter. Check the power button. Contact Autel support.
Software Won’t Update Check your internet connection. Verify your subscription status. Restart the MaxiSys. Contact Autel support.
Can’t Connect to Vehicle Check the OBDII cable. Verify vehicle compatibility. Try a different vehicle. Check for DTCs in the vehicle’s diagnostic system.
Inaccurate Readings Calibrate the MaxiSys. Check for software updates. Verify sensor data with a multimeter. Contact Autel support.
Tool Freezes or Crashes Restart the MaxiSys. Clear the cache. Update the software. Contact Autel support.
Bluetooth Connectivity Issues Ensure Bluetooth is enabled. Re-pair the device. Update Bluetooth drivers. Move closer to the device.
Wi-Fi Connection Problems Verify Wi-Fi is enabled. Check the network password. Restart the router. Move closer to the router.
Touchscreen Unresponsive Clean the screen. Restart the device. Update the software. Contact Autel support.
